Thyme plant is safe for cats. This, therefore, means that you can let your cat eat thyme. However, as a rule of thumb, only give them a very small amount. It will help in improving digestion, inhibit bacterial and fungal growth since it has thymol, boost your kitty’s immunity (has vitamin C and antioxidants) and help in hairball removal.
